- Download the repository by clicking on the "Code" tab, clicking the "< > Code" button, then downloading as a ZIP. Additionally, you can also use ```git clone https://codes.fll-65266.org/Arcmyx/pynamics.git```. Unzip the archive and open code.pybricks.com. Then choose which folder you'd like to use, and open each file in Pybricks by using the import button. For example, to use the diagnostics tool, simply open each program in the ```diagnostics``` folder into Pybricks. Then, follow the instructions for each utility.

- Diagnostics - a program that allows you to diagnose issues and test parts of your robot, such as battery, motor, and color sensor. Open each program in the ```diagnostics``` folder in Pybricks, (you can select all of them at once) connect your robot, switch to the ```FullDiagnostics.py``` file and press run. The program might take a bit to compile, since there are thousands of lines of code being imported from the other files (partly the reason why the Pynamics IDE will be an improvement, since the Pynamics team will distribute the pre-compiled bytecode)
